## Authentication

The Glacierbin archiver requires a service credential to read and seal cold storage buckets. Contractors receive a scoped key valid for the archiving pipeline only; it cannot list live buckets. Export it as an environment variable before running the archive script, and never commit it. Your key for the archiving service is shown below.

service key, fawip-bajef: kto11_Qt5wZK9vdNC

/*
 * RestockPilot client setup — for external plugin authors.
 * This client talks to the Corridor restock-planning API: it pulls
 * machine inventory snapshots, predicts sell-through, and returns a
 * suggested restock route. Plugins must call init() before any
 * planner methods. Rate limit: 60 req/min per plugin. Sandbox data
 * only; production machines are off-limits. Initialize the client
 * with the key below.
 */

API key for bahop-yajog: qvz3-mhf

TURN-208: Gatevale turnstile counters at the Merrow Field pilot double-count when a rotation reverses mid-cycle. Attendance totals drift roughly 2% high per event. The debounce window fix is implemented, reviewed by Ilsa, and soak-tested across two simulated match days without drift. Ready for your cut; the candidate build is identified below.

trace token, tagag-tafog: htk6_5ed18c

**Vendor note: Inkmill markdown pipeline**

Rendering for Parchway docs is outsourced to Inkmill under an annual contract, renewing each March. They handle sanitization and PDF export; we own the upload queue. SLA: 4-hour response on rendering failures. Escalate only after two failed retries. Their support desk is reachable at the address below.

billing contact of hahaf-baguf = zorael.tammir.jorius@sivrelhq.internal